About This Book

They were car guys and they were getting old. Johnny, Cecil, Mike, Tommy, Kyle and Greg; friends since high school; men in their mid-sixties; more than any other signifier they could imagine, they were car guys. Their garages are filled with shrines of pristine pistons and finely polished chrome. Aged autos far from dinosaurs, they were without flaw, cared for meticulously like the children of first-time parents, and loved unconditionally, even when a distributor cap wouldn't budge. They were bragged about and they were touched up regularly. Their owners, though, unlike the cars, were undoubtedly falling apart. Whether it was blood pressure, cholesterol, hips needing replacement or little blue pills hidden in coat pockets, their bodies were beginning to require more attention than their cars. Despite their aging bodies, it was time for the Dream Cruise, the once a year Detroit event for guys to show off their cars, get into a little bit of trouble and, more importantly than anything else, bond with their friends, and the guys were undoubtedly ready.
